How Thyroid Carcinoma Surgery Actually Works

Thyroid carcinoma surgery involves removing the part of the thyroid gland containing cancer cells. This can be achieved through a traditional open surgery or a minimally invasive procedure. The type of surgery chosen depends on various factors, including the type and size of the tumor, as well as the patient's overall health.
During the surgery, the doctor uses a combination of cutting-edge technology and surgical expertise to locate and remove the cancerous tissue. In some cases, this may involve the removal of the entire thyroid gland, while in others, only the affected area may be removed. The goal is to ensure the cancer is fully eliminated while preserving the functioning of the remaining thyroid tissue.
Common Questions People Have About Thyroid Carcinoma Surgery
What's the difference between thyroid carcinoma surgery and thyroid cancer treatment?
Thyroid carcinoma surgery is a specific type of surgical procedure that aims to remove the cancerous tissue from the thyroid gland. While thyroid cancer treatment encompasses a broader range of options, including hormone therapy and targeted radiation, surgery is often the first line of defense.

How long does it take to recover from thyroid carcinoma surgery?
Recovery time varies from patient to patient but generally takes several weeks to a few months. Patients may experience fatigue, pain, and swelling, but these symptoms are usually manageable with proper care and follow-up appointments.
